`
thoreau
  • 浏览: 356121 次
  • 性别: Icon_minigender_1
  • 来自: 上海
社区版块
存档分类
最新评论
文章列表
转自:https://blog.csdn.net/liujinsuoabc/article/details/18354275   最近在封装Excel组件,需要提供两个接口,分别根据单元索引和单元名称访问单元格。例如,GetCell(1, 2)和GetCell(“A2”),这两种方法返回的结果是相同的。这里遇到一个问题,如何在单元索引([1,2])和单元名称(A2)之间相互转换?由于在单元索引和单元名称中,行号是相同的,所以我们只需要转换列号就可以了。本来以为是个很简单的问题,结果调试了好长时间才搞定。于是写了这篇文章,总结一下。   【问题描述】 在Excel中,列的名称是这样一 ...
文章转自 https://www.cnblogs.com/popfisher/p/5466174.html     每次使用Git的时候都或多或少遇到些问题,为了方便以后少踩一些坑,把自己踩过的坑记录一下,加深对Git使用的理解,所以写下这篇日记记录一下。   本文需要频繁使用cmd,如果使用系统的cmd会稍微有点不便   所以这里先推荐一款Windows平台上面个人觉得比较好用的一款cmd工具ConEmu
   转自:http://www.cnblogs.com/labnizejuly/p/5588444.html   FormData对象,是可以使用一系列的键值对来模拟一个完整的表单,然后使用XMLHttpRequest发送这个"表单"。   在 Mozilla Developer 网站 使用FormData对象 有详尽的FormData对象使用说明。 但上传文件部分只有底层的XMLHttpRequest对象发送上传请求,那么怎么通过jQuery的Ajax上传呢?本文将介绍通过jQuery使用FormData对象上传文件。   HTML代码 
 转自:http://blog.csdn.net/qq_29216083/article/details/77678981   使用mybatis查询数据时,如果数据库存储的是timestamp、datetime、date、time等时间类型,而Java bean也使用的是date类型,mybatis会自动将date类型转换为unix long时间eg:1503912320000,而不是时间格式。 解决方式有两种: 1.将Java bean 中的类型改为String类型。 2.在java bean 中date类型的get方法上加上注解@JsonFormat jackson中有一个@J ...
l转自:http://www.cnblogs.com/linjiqin/p/4530311.html   定时任务轮询比如任务自服务器启动就开始运行,并且每隔5秒执行一次。 以下用spring注解配置定时任务。1、添加相应的schema
参考文章:http://blog.csdn.net/lishuangzhe7047/article/details/46044323     1.编写调用dll的java类 public class JDataEncryption { static { try { System.loadLibrary("TL_Jdll"); } catch(Exception e) { } } public native String Decryption_Data(String value); }  2.打开 ...
转自:http://blog.csdn.net/hzqhbc/article/details/50738997   1、redis简介redis是一个key-value存储系统。和Memcached类似,它支持存储的value类型相对更多,包括string(字符串)、list(链表)、set(集合)、zset(sorted set --有序集合)和hashs(哈希类型)。这些数据类型都支持push/pop、add/remove及取交集并集和差集及更丰富的操作,而且这些操作都是原子性的。在此基础上,redis支持各种不同方式的排序。与memcached一样,为了保证效率,数据都是缓存在内存 ...
转自:http://www.cnblogs.com/hongwz/p/5456578.html     一.前言     以前做过的项目中,没有真正的使用过Maven,只知道其名声很大,其作用是用来管理jar 包的。最近一段时间在项目过程中使用Maven,用Maven构建的web项目,其项目结构只停留在了解阶段,没有深入的使用与理解,刚好最近看了一篇关于Maven的详解;就开始深入学习一下Maven的具体应用。 二.Maven的作用 在开发中,为了保证编译通过,我们会到处去寻找jar包,当编译通过了,运行的时候,却发现"ClassNotFoundException&qu ...
转自:http://xiaoyaojones.blog.163.com/blog/static/28370125201351501113581/     1、windows下的NodeJS安装是比较方便的(v0.6.0版本之后,支持windows native),只需要登陆官网(http://nodejs.org/),便可以看到首页的“INSTALL”按钮,直接点击就会自动下载安装了。
转自:http://www.cnblogs.com/ShoneH/p/5587358.html     C# 几十万级数据导出Excel,及Excel各种操作   先上导出代码 /// <summary> ///
原文地址:http://blog.icoolxue.com/submitted-by-spring-mvc-to-prevent-data-duplication/   token的逻辑是,给所有的url加一个拦截器,在拦截器里面用java的UUID生成一个随机的UUID并把这个UUID放到session里面,然后在浏览器做数据提交的时候将此UUID提交到服务器。服务器在接收到此UUID后,检查一下该UUID是否已经被提交,如果已经被提交,则不让逻辑继续执行下去…   总体的步骤是: 1.添加token注解 2.创建过滤器 3.配置过滤器过滤所有请求 4.在需要生成token的 ...
使用POI导出数据库大量数据,使用的主要jar包:poi-3.8-20120326.jar、poi-ooxml-3.8-20120326.jar   样例代码: import java.io.FileOutputStream; import java.util.List; import java.util.Map; import org.apache.poi.ss.usermodel.Cell; import org.apache.poi.ss.usermodel.Row; import org.apache.poi.ss.usermodel.Sheet; import ...

C# DataMatrix.net使用

    博客分类:
  • C#
使用DataMatrix.net.dll来生成二维码,可控制二维码长宽   样例代码: DmtxImageEncoder Die = new DmtxImageEncoder(); DataMatrix.net.DmtxImageEncoderOptions option = new DmtxImageEncoderOptions(); option.SizeIdx = DmtxSymbolSize.DmtxSymbol16x16;//形状 option.MarginSize = 0;//边距 option.ModuleSize = 3;//点阵大小 string txt ...
  转自:http://blog.csdn.net/xinyue3054/article/details/7895166   最近在开发项目中,遇到的一个问题是: 在 tomcat中发布一个web项目,但是发布成功后,只能用http://localhost:8080/fm访问项目,不能用 http://127.0.0.1:8080/fm访问项目,也不能用本地的IP地址访问(http://192.16/8.0.191:8080/fm) 起初认为是防火墙的原因,但是防火墙是关闭的,应该没有影响; 后来认为是win7的原因,那个远程那有个不允许远程访问,但是更改了都没有效果; 再 ...
  java的日志打印使用默认的e.printStackTrace()时,有时只能打印的空信息,项目上线后,针对日志做分析时如果有这样的情况挺尴尬,对于此情况可以通过如下方式来处理 e.printStackTrace(); ByteArrayOutputStream baos = new ByteArrayOutputStream(); e.printStackTrace(new PrintStream(baos)); String exception = baos.toString(); //exception即异常的全部内容,在此处可以将其保存在日志文件中 logger.i ...
Global site tag (gtag.js) - Google Analytics